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10 07618392321 1582206
0579 22084528 2825097840
0579 22084528 2825097840
95584044 124 673 71866907 98059533
All about undefined
Interested in learning more?
0579 22084528 2825097840
95584044 124 673 71866907 98059533
See more
15032738 578 631127724
80198 8685112 52446294780 249
See more
707692 7052890
66 38568 92033
See more